freeswitch通过bridge+定制化distributor,进行sip媒体的负载均衡代理

1.代理服务器上配置default.xml中,配置dialplan内容为:

<condition field="destination number" expression="^(35\d{2})$">

<action application="bridge" data="{origination_caller_id_number=${caller_id_number}

name}}sofia/:internal/sip:1@{distributor($1:fslist)}"/>

2.配置distributor.conf.xml内容为:其中node节点为代理的后端fs节点地址。

通过distributor的随机选择节点功能,即可实现动态fs的media代理

相关推荐
matlab的学徒7 小时前
Web与Nginx网站服务(改)
linux·运维·前端·nginx·tomcat
盖世英雄酱581368 小时前
Read timed out问题 排查
java·数据库·后端
狼爷8 小时前
破解 JetBrains 的学生,后来都成了它的 “推销员”:一场用习惯换市场的长期战
java·jetbrains
从零开始学习人工智能8 小时前
快速搭建B/S架构HTML演示页:从工具选择到实战落地
前端·架构·html
.豆鲨包8 小时前
【Android】Viewpager2实现无限轮播图
android·java
BXCQ_xuan8 小时前
软件工程实践二:Spring Boot 知识回顾
java·spring boot·后端
老赵的博客8 小时前
c++ unqiue指针
java·jvm·c++
wuxuanok9 小时前
SpringBoot -原理篇
java·spring boot·spring
虫虫rankourin9 小时前
在 create-react-app (CRA) 创建的应用中使用 react-router-dom v7以及懒加载的使用方法
前端·react.js
柿蒂9 小时前
从if-else和switch,聊聊“八股“的作用
android·java·kotlin